当前位置: 首页 > news >正文

【mysql】02在ubuntu24安装并配置mysql

安装

sudo apt-get update
sudo apt-get install mysql-server

设置root密码

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'new_password';FLUSH PRIVILEGES;

添加用户并设置远程可访问

添加用户并赋予权限

CREATE USER 'remote_user'@'%' IDENTIFIED BY 'Password@123';
GRANT ALL PRIVILEGES ON *.* TO 'remote_user'@'%' WITH GRANT OPTION;
FLUSH PRIVILEGES;

编辑配置文件

sudo nano /etc/mysql/my.cnf

修改 bind-address 配置项

[mysqld]
bind-address = 0.0.0.0

重启mysql

sudo service mysql restart

配置防火墙

sudo ufw allow 3306/tcp

相关文章:

  • 北京网站建设多少钱?
  • 辽宁网页制作哪家好_网站建设
  • 高端品牌网站建设_汉中网站制作
  • 【区块链 + 智慧政务】澳门:智慧城市建设之证书电子化项目 | FISCO BCOS应用案例
  • 单元测试有什么好处呢?
  • 【代码随想录_Day30】1049. 最后一块石头的重量 II 494. 目标和 474.一和零
  • SpringBoot集成Sharding-JDBC-5.3.0实现按月动态建表分表
  • 采用自动微分进行模型的训练
  • 睡前故事—绿色科技的未来:可持续发展的梦幻故事
  • 数据建设实践之大数据平台(五)安装hive
  • 企业网络实验(vmware虚拟机充当DHCP服务器)所有IP全部保留,只为已知mac分配固定IP
  • 从产品手册用户心理学分析到程序可用性与易用性的重要区别
  • 启智畅想火车类集装箱号码识别技术,软硬件解决方案
  • 新一代大语言模型 GPT-5 对工作与生活的影响及应对策略
  • LDAPWordlistHarvester:基于LDAP数据的字典生成工具
  • django-ckeditor富文本编辑器
  • 团体程序设计天梯赛-练习集
  • Ubuntu上安装配置samba服务
  • @angular/forms 源码解析之双向绑定
  • 【JavaScript】通过闭包创建具有私有属性的实例对象
  • 【跃迁之路】【463天】刻意练习系列222(2018.05.14)
  • 07.Android之多媒体问题
  • conda常用的命令
  • Elasticsearch 参考指南(升级前重新索引)
  • PHP的Ev教程三(Periodic watcher)
  • SQLServer之创建数据库快照
  • unity如何实现一个固定宽度的orthagraphic相机
  • vagrant 添加本地 box 安装 laravel homestead
  • Vultr 教程目录
  • yii2中session跨域名的问题
  • 半理解系列--Promise的进化史
  • 蓝海存储开关机注意事项总结
  • 力扣(LeetCode)21
  • 如何合理的规划jvm性能调优
  • 如何用vue打造一个移动端音乐播放器
  • 时间复杂度与空间复杂度分析
  • 写代码的正确姿势
  • 在Mac OS X上安装 Ruby运行环境
  • 数据可视化之下发图实践
  • #### go map 底层结构 ####
  • #{}和${}的区别是什么 -- java面试
  • #Datawhale AI夏令营第4期#AIGC文生图方向复盘
  • #window11设置系统变量#
  • (k8s中)docker netty OOM问题记录
  • (阿里云在线播放)基于SpringBoot+Vue前后端分离的在线教育平台项目
  • (编程语言界的丐帮 C#).NET MD5 HASH 哈希 加密 与JAVA 互通
  • (二) Windows 下 Sublime Text 3 安装离线插件 Anaconda
  • (附源码)spring boot基于Java的电影院售票与管理系统毕业设计 011449
  • (三) diretfbrc详解
  • (实战篇)如何缓存数据
  • (转)Oracle存储过程编写经验和优化措施
  • (轉)JSON.stringify 语法实例讲解
  • .NET Core MongoDB数据仓储和工作单元模式封装
  • .Net MVC + EF搭建学生管理系统
  • .NET MVC 验证码
  • .NET3.5下用Lambda简化跨线程访问窗体控件,避免繁复的delegate,Invoke(转)
  • .NET开源的一个小而快并且功能强大的 Windows 动态桌面软件 - DreamScene2
  • .net网站发布-允许更新此预编译站点